Who wins? : Thu May 16, 2024 5:19 pm  
During these depressing times for us. The chat is nauseating. So I want to start a few threads to try and get some positivity back by talking about some good times for us.

This thread is called who wins?

So this one is who wins in a match from our two most successful teams of the Super league era?

The 05/06 team vs the 16/17 team. Reasons why and some of your memories from great performances of those times?

Re: Who wins? : Thu May 16, 2024 6:19 pm  
We had a great squad in 2004 and were second for most of the season but injuries took their toll and we dropped to third so missed having two chances to get to the Grand Final. For the Wakefield game we were missing Jason Smith, Richie Barnett (Snr), Rich Horne and Kingy. Cooke played but wasn't fit.
